    Growing Electric Vehicle Market

    The expansion of the electric vehicle market is a significant driver for the Global Fiber Batteries Market Industry. As consumers increasingly opt for electric vehicles, the demand for efficient and lightweight battery solutions rises. Fiber batteries, with their potential for high energy density and reduced weight, present an attractive alternative to traditional lithium-ion batteries. This trend is further supported by the global push for reducing carbon emissions and enhancing energy efficiency in transportation. The market's growth trajectory, projected to reach 12.5 USD Billion in 2024, indicates the pivotal role that fiber batteries will play in meeting the energy storage needs of the burgeoning electric vehicle sector.

    Fibre Batteries Market  Battery Technology Insights

    Fibre Batteries Market  Battery Technology Insights

    The Fibre Batteries Market fibre battery market is divided by battery technology into lithium-ion batteries, solid-state batteries, polymer batteries, and alkaline batteries. The market is currently dominated by lithium-ion batteries, which generated over 80% of the market’s revenue in 2023. This is because this type of fibre battery features high energy density, long shelf life, and quick charging, which benefits a variety of applications, including laptops, smartphones, and electric vehicles. However, the demand for solid-state batteries is forecasted to rise significantly in the following years due to their higher energy density and improved safety.

    At the same time, polymer batteries will also witness an increase in their market share due to their flexible and lightweight design. On the other hand, alkaline batteries are the most widespread type of battery because they are used across a range of low-power applications such as a remote control and toys, and the popularity of this product is not expected to decline in the future due to their low cost, and longer shelf life. The main product types are reviewed in Table 7 in the Appendix.

    Fibre Batteries Market  Application Insights

    Fibre Batteries Market  Application Insights

    The Fibre Batteries Market is segmented into Consumer electronics, Automotive, Energy storage systems, Medical devices, and Industrial machinery. Among these, the automotive segment is expected to hold the largest market share during the forecast period. The growth of the automotive segment is primarily driven by the increasing demand for electric vehicles (EVs). EVs require high-performance batteries with long lifespans and fast charging capabilities, which fibre batteries can provide. The consumer electronics segment is also expected to witness significant growth during the forecast period.

    Fibre batteries offer several advantages for consumer electronics, such as high energy density, long lifespan, and fast charging capabilities. These advantages make fibre batteries ideal for use in smartphones, laptops, tablets, and other portable devices. The energy storage systems segment is another key growth area for the Fibre Batteries Market Fibre battery market. Fibre batteries can provide long-duration energy storage, which is essential for grid stability and the integration of renewable energy sources. In addition, fibre batteries can be used for backup power applications, such as in data centers and hospitals.

    Fibre Batteries Market  Form Factor Insights

    Fibre Batteries Market  Form Factor Insights

    The Form Factor segment of the Fibre Batteries Market is broadly classified into cylindrical batteries, Pouch batteries, Prismatic batteries, and Laminated batteries. Among these, cylindrical batteries are projected to hold the largest market share in 2023, owing to their high energy density and wide range of applications in various industries, especially in power tools, electric vehicles, and portable electronics.

    Prismatic batteries are expected to witness the fastest growth rate during the forecast period due to their compact size and high-power output, making them suitable for consumer electronics and electric vehicles.Pouch batteries offer flexibility in design and are cost-effective, which is driving their adoption in emerging markets, while Laminated batteries provide high energy density and are used in applications requiring long cycle life.

    Fibre Batteries Market  Capacity Insights

    Fibre Batteries Market  Capacity Insights

    The Fibre Batteries Market is segmented by Capacity into Low capacity (less than 1000 mAh), Medium capacity (1000-5000 mAh), and High capacity (more than 5000 mAh). The medium capacity segment is expected to hold the largest market share in 2023, owing to its wide range of applications in portable electronic devices. The high-capacity segment is expected to witness the highest growth rate during the forecast period due to the increasing demand for high-performance batteries in electric vehicles and renewable energy applications.

    The growing adoption of electric vehicles is driving the demand for high-capacity batteries, as they offer longer driving ranges and faster charging times.Additionally, the increasing penetration of renewable energy sources, such as solar and wind power, is driving the demand for high-capacity batteries for energy storage.

    Industry Developments

    The Fibre Batteries Market fibre battery market is projected to reach USD 29.72 billion by 2034, exhibiting a CAGR of 9.82% during the forecast period (2025-2034). This growth is attributed to the increasing demand for lightweight, flexible, and high-power density energy storage solutions in various applications such as consumer electronics, electric vehicles, and grid storage. Recent news developments in the fibre battery market include strategic partnerships and collaborations between key players to enhance product offerings and expand market reach.

    For instance, in 2023, Samsung SDI and Solus Advanced Materials announced a partnership to develop and produce high-performance fibre batteries for electric vehicles.

    Technological advancements, such as the development of new materials and manufacturing processes, are also driving market growth. For example, the use of carbon nanotubes and graphene in fibre batteries is expected to improve energy density and cycle life.Key market players include Samsung SDI, Solus Advanced Materials, Enfucell, and Blue Current. These companies are focusing on research and development to introduce innovative products and maintain their market positions.
